Manuale Pratico di Linux (Slackware Distribution)

by Nanni Bassetti

1) Come iniziare ? Per prima cosa bisogna creare 2 partizioni sul proprio Hard Disk

Una partizione servira' per istallare Linux e l'altra per lo swap-file. Naturalmente durante l'istallazione bisogna far formattare le partizioni da Linux.

Poi bisogna creare il BOOTDISK ed il ROOTDISK :

I) BOOTDISK rawrite bare.i a:

II) ROOTDISK rawrite color.gz a:

Se, invece, si vuole istallare Linux in una partizione DOS (senza creare le partizioni native Linux): rawrite umsdos.gz a:

Infine lanciare il SETUP.EXE e seguire le istruzioni !!! 2) Con UMSDOS Se si e' scelto di usare la partizione DOS, allora non bisognera' istallare il LILO, ma si dovra' copiare il VMLINUZ in una directory es: c:\loadlin e li' copiare anche il LOADLIN.EXE, programma col quale si potra' lanciare Linux dal prompt di DOS.

3) Linux ! Se si e' optato per il partizionamento, si dovra' istallare il LILO (LInuxLOader, verra' richiestp durante l'istallazione).

Il LILO puo' far partire Linux dall'MBR (Master Boot Sector) ed in questo caso se si vorra' disinstallare Linux, bisognera' prima, al prompt di Linux, eseguire: lilo -U Se invece si e' resa ATTIVA la partizione nativa di Linux, allora conviene istallare il LILO nella ROOT nativa, cosi' non infastidisce l'MBR dal quale partono gli altri sistemi operativi eventualmente gia' istallati !

4) Il Kernel Una volta istallato Linux si deve ricompilare il Kernel, in modo da adattare, perfettamente, il sistema operativo alla propria macchina bisogna: I) decompattare il sorgente del kernel nella dir: /usr/src/nome_kernel es.: tar zxvf nome_kernel.tgz /usr/src

II) Eseguire: rm linux (in /usr/src)

III) Eseguire: ln -s /usr/src/nomedelladirdel_kernel linux

IV) Eseguire: cd linux

V) make menuconfig

VI) make dep VII) make clean

VIII) make zlilo (oppure se si usa UMSDOS make zImage)

IX) alla fine eseguire: reboot 5) Montare i devices

I) Montare il floppy driver. andare nella root: cd / creare un file chiamato "a" o come vi pare (jed a oppure vi a) nel file scrivere: umount /dosa mount /dev/fd0 /dosa cd /dosa ls --color uscire dal file salvando creare la directory /dosa : mkdir /dosa attivare il file "a": chmod 777 a spostare il file nella directory /bin: mv a /bin eseguire: a + invio.

II) Montare il CD-ROM: cd /etc/rc.d/ chmod 744 rc.cdrom rc.cdrom + invio Per cambiare cd-rom disk bisogna smontare il device e poi rimontarlo umount /cdrom (smontare) cambiare disco mount /cdrom oppure rc.cdrom

6) Convertire un dile root in un file BIN : chown root.bin nomefile

7) Varie I) Cercare un File Per cercare un file bisogna creare il database di Linux digitando: updatedb

Poi per cercare il file bisogna digitare : locate nomefile

II) Distruggere i processi attivi Per avere una lista dei processi attivi basta digitare: ps Per distrugger un processo bisogna digitare: kill [numero_PID_del processo]

Se un processo ha bloccato il sistema, conviene aprire un'altra sessione di Linux con: alt+F1 o alt+F2 p alt+F3 etc. etc. e da li' eseguire un kill del processo.

III) Per configurare in genere ;-) Quasi tutti i file per le configurazioni sono nelle directories: /usr/lib/httpd/conf /var/lib/httpd/conf /etc /etc/rc.d Il file che chiama parecchi moduli al boot e': /etc/rc.d/rc.M Porte d'accesso ai servizi: http 80 ftp 21 telnet 23 news 119 mailto 25 gopher 70

IV) Per aggiungere uno user: "adduser" (poi seguire le istruzioni) per cambiare la password al root : "passwd"

V) Il PPPD: Il PPPD e' il demone de permette a Linux di inizializzare il protocollo ppp (Point - to - Point Protocol), i file da contollare sono: /usr/sbin/ ppp-on, ppp-off /etc resolv.conf /etc/ppp ppp-on-dialer options pap-secrets (eventualmente si usa il PAP [Personal Authentication Protocol) Lanciando ppp-on parte la connessione

------------------------------------------------------- FINE